Hyvolution Non-thermal production of pur hydrogen from biomass
01.01.2006 - 31.12.2011
Research funding project
HYVOLUTION is an Integrated Project within the EU¿s 6th Framework Programme on Sustainable Energy Systems with the aim to develop a blue-print for an industrial bioprocess for decentral hydrogen production at small-scale from locally produced biomass. The novel approach in HYVOLUTION - based on a combined bioprocess employing thermophilic and phototrophic bacteria, to provide the highest hydrogen production efficiency in small-scale, cost effective industries - will help meeting the target to deliver a 10-25 % coverage of the EU demand for hydrogen, for use in power or bio-fuel production, at 10 Euro/GJ. The 2-stage bioprocess consists of a thermophilic fermentation step to produce hydrogen, CO2 and intermediates followed by a photo-heterotrophic fermentation, in which all intermediates will be converted to hydrogen and CO2, to achieve an efficiency of 75%. Dedicated gas upgrading is developed for optimal gas cleaning and gas quality protocols at small-scale production units. The units must be designed to handle small and frequently changing flow rates with different compositions. Modelling and simulation of the unit processes together with innovative system integration and combining mass and energy balances with exergy analyses, will provide minimal energy demand and maximal product output and therefore reduce production costs. Process integration also involves the development of control strategies for the novel bioprocess. In HYVOLUTION, 11 EU countries, Turkey and Russia are represented. The multinational and multidisciplinary consortium consists of prominent specialists from academia and industries as well as 7 SME's which warrants high quality and commercial exploitation of project results.
